[ブログ]のGithubでオープンソースの上にカスタムドメイン名Hexoブログ

A.構成環境

1.ダウンロードしてインストールgitの

ダウンロードGitのリンク:https://git-scm.com/downloads
注32ビットまたは64ビットの正しいを選択します。

2.ダウンロードしてインストールのNode.js

Node.jsのダウンロードリンク:http://nodejs.cn/download/
同上32ビットまたは64ビットを選択します。
インストールが成功した場合は正常にインストールした後、入力ノード-vとNPM -vを見ることができます。
コンピュータを再起動します

3.設定Hexo

1.新しいフォルダを、右の文字のコンピュータを作成し、gitのベースをクリックしてください。以下のような:D:\ Githubの\ HEXOを
入力します:

npm install hexo-cli -g 

インストールhexo

hexo他のコマンド

$ hexo g

完全なコマンドは次のとおりです。hexoが静的ファイルを生成するために使用されて生成します

$ hexo s

完全なコマンドは次のとおりです。サーバを起動するために使用さhexoサーバ、主に地元のプレビュー

$ hexo d

完全なコマンドは次のとおりです。githubの上のローカルファイルに公開するためのhexoデプロイ

$ hexo n 

完全なコマンドは新しいためhexo新品です

3. Gitのバッシュを入力し、入力します。

hexo init   

初期化倉庫
4.入力の依存関係がインストールさ:

npm install 

成功した後、次のコマンドを入力します。

hexo g 

そして、:

hexo s

5.ブラウザでhttpを入力してください:// localhostを:4000 /ローカルプレビューを表示することができます

二.Hexo関連する構成

次のテーマを有効にします。1.

自分の名前でHexoに2つのメインの設定ファイルがあります_config.ymlます。
このうち、ルートディレクトリにあるサイトでは、主要な構成Hexo自体が含まれています。他には、テーマディレクトリに配置され、この構成では、主題に関連する設定するための主要なオプションの主題により提供。
説明の便宜上、以下の説明では、テーマの設定ファイルと呼ばれるサイト設定ファイル、として知られている元。

私たちは、サイトの構成ファイルを開き、テーマのフィールドを検索し、次の値を変更します。
正常に設定した後、その後、gitのベースhexoを使用して再起動し、少し待っhexoグラムを入力してhexo sが次のトピックと成功した使用を見ることができます。

2.NexT構成

外観の設定
開いたテーマ設定ファイル、その後、独自のテーマを選択し、#コメントにスキームを持ち上げます。

Muse - 默认 Scheme,这是 NexT 最初的版本,黑白主调,大量留白
Mist - Muse 的紧凑版本,整洁有序的单栏外观
Pisces - 双栏 Scheme,小家碧玉似的清新

注意:あなたはスタイルを設定した後のスペースを持っている必要があります

言語設定は
、サイトの構成ファイルを開き、言語を見つけ、その後、音声の種類を設定します。
次の表に示されるように、次の現在サポートされている言語:
言語コードの設定例

English	en	language: en
简体中文	zh-Hans	language: zh-Hans
Français	fr-FR	language: fr-FR
Português	pt	language: pt or language: pt-BR
繁體中文	zh-hk 或者 zh-tw	language: zh-hk
Русский язык	ru	language: ru
Deutsch	de	language: de
日本語	ja	language: ja
Indonesian	id	language: id
Korean	ko	language: ko

メニュー設定
開いたテーマ設定ファイルには、メニューを見つけ、その後、メインメニューの表示を選択します。
次のデフォルトのメニュー項目が(マークされた項目は、手動でこのページを作成する必要性を表明):
キー値が表示テキスト(簡体字中国語)に設定されています

home	home: /	主页
archives	archives: /archives	归档页
categories	categories: /categories	分类页 
tags	tags: /tags	标签页 
about	about: /about	关于页面 
commonweal	commonweal: /404.html	公益 404

設定が完了したら、メニューの翻訳でメニューに対応する適切なテキストを、設定する必要があります。
言語/ {言語} .yml、およびエディットリストに対応する記述が見つかりました。
以下のような:ZH-ハンス、ZH-Hans.ymlを開く:言語を設定する言語です。

アバターが設定されている
ライン上のアバターアバターパス入力を編集し、テーマ設定ファイルに。
中hexo /公共/画像の画像。
以下のような:アバター:/images/ljnoit.png

Baiduの統計
住所:https://tongji.baidu.com/web/welcome/login
伐採後(登録されていない)、そして新しいウェブサイトは、オンライン上のドメイン名を入力し、その背後にあるhm.jsをコピーし、jsのコードの束があるでしょうか?統計スクリプト文字列IDは、その行のテーマ設定ファイルbaidu_analyticsに貼り付けます。

社会的なリンクの
編集対象プロファイルとライン上の社会的なリンクと命令を高めます。
たとえばます。https://blog.csdn.net/Ljnoit

ラベルの分類
サイトディレクトリの下に、gitのはbashを開いて、分類を作成するためにhexo新しいページ「カテゴリ」を入力します。
入力:hexo新しいページの「タグ」hexo新ページ「約」 とのラベルを作成します。
、index.mdファイルのあるフォルダ、については、カテゴリー、タグを追加する中国のため開封後の記述を変更します次のサイトディレクトリソースフォルダでプレーを作成し、中国も表示されます。
コメントは、オープンカテゴリページ、表示されませんプラグインのコメントを意味し、falseに設定することができます。

地元の三.Hexo協会のgithubのブログとアップロード

1. githubの上の上のリポジトリを作成します。

(ない最初に作成して作成)に成功したログインgithubの後、倉庫、ユーザー名の倉庫youname.github.io youname名の形式を作成します。たとえば、次のようにljnoit.github.io

正常に作成された後の後、ちょうどテーマを選択し、その後、テーマを選択してください選択し、倉庫をクリックして設定を選択し、[GitHubのページインターフェイスをドラッグします。パスにアクセスするためのパスがある、あなたが設定リポジトリのインターフェースにアクセスすることができます見つけることができるためにGitHubのページへの設定を再度クリックしてください。

2.Hexo協会のGithub

この倉庫同じに関連する以前の段階。

セットGitの身元情報
ディレクトリhexo右のgitベース入力で:

git config --global user.name "你的用户名"
git config --global user.email "你的邮箱"

.gitを追加するには、プラスサイト構成ファイル内の倉庫の住所、注意を払います

ブログを公開3

まず、新しいブログ投稿。
以下のような:hexo新しいポスト「こんにちはGitHubのは、」
こんにちはGitHub.mdファイルが表示されます\ソース\ _postsになります。
\ source_postsパスの下にブログ上で公開されます。ブログは、名前た.md値下げエディタをお勧めします。

リリース前に、ブログの最初の編集者は、説明を書き込みます。そして、次のコマンドを入力します。

hexo g //生成静态文件  
hexo s // 本地预览

そして、次のように入力しますhexo dはgithubのに投稿されました。
成功の後のブログを見ることができyouname.github.ioパスを入力します。

IV。ドメイン名の登録とのGithubにバインド

アリ雲はまず、ログインコンソールで見つかったドメイン名やドメイン名を検索します。それは登録することができて見つけることを意味場合は入力した後、最初のクエリのドメイン名は、あなたは、適用したいです。多くのドメイン名登録の拡張子はそうならば、.COMをお勧めします、があります。
ドメイン名の適用が成功した後、ドメイン名とGithubには、IPアドレスをバインド、またはGitHubのは192.30.252.153 192.30.252.154です。我々は時間を埋めるために解決して、このアドレスを解決します。Githubのは、私たちの倉庫、CNAMEの設定を見つける方法です。
ドメイン名解決を入力した後解決し、[追加]をクリックし、適切なコンテンツでターン塗りつぶしに。
「レコードタイプ」を選択A;「ホストレコード」フィルWWW;「分析ライン」を選択デフォルト、
IPアドレス提供githubの中に「録画」塗りつぶし、192.30.252.153 192.30.252.154または、
「TTL」デフォルトは10分、彼らは別にすることができます設定ができ;
そして最後に[保存]をクリックしてください。

成功したドメイン名解決した後、上記のあなたのGithubリポジトリにCNAMEを作成し、あなたがドメイン名の申請アドレスを入力します。次に、あなたのドメイン名がGithubのブログにアクセスすることができます入力してください。

公開された21元の記事 ウォン称賛30 ビュー4285

おすすめ

転載: blog.csdn.net/Ljnoit/article/details/104043776